Web-enabled 3D talking avatars based on WebGL and HTML5
We describe a system for plugin-free deployment of 3D talking characters on the web. The system employs the WebGL capabilites of modern web browsers in order to produce real-time animation of speech movements, in synchrony with text-to-speech synthesis, played back using HTML5 audio functionalty. متن کاملDigital Archiving of Traditional Songket Motifs using Image Processing Tool
This paper presents an image processing tool, part of an image retrieval system, that provides digitization of songket motifs extracted from songket patterns. Songket motifs are acquired from their original songket fabrics and digitized into binary form by using several image processing techniques. متن کاملGradient-Based Edge Detection of Songket Motifs
This paper discussed the effectiveness of several popular gradientbased edge detection techniques when applied on binary images of songket motifs. Five edge detector algorithms that is Roberts, Sobel, Prewitt, Laplacian of Gaussian and Canny are applied to twenty-five Malaysian traditional songket motifs.
